Transaction

9cdddbe630f80a2a032c7e0016203f1d5072d6be50ea8aee2b4f57594ca569c3
305,490 confirmations
Timestamp
1591905524
Block634,267
Fee2,656 sats
Fee rate4 sats/vB
view on mempool.space

Inputs & Outputs